Mumbai Crime: Film producer accused of dumping injured dog to die

Shaailesh Singh says the dog had already died when his driver took it to the hospital; they had left it on a road as cremation could not be done at night

A stray dog died after she was hit by a BMW car owned by a Bollywood producer outside his society in Goregaon West. An animal activist has alleged that the Shaailesh Singh was driving the car at the time and he got the dog dumped somewhere when it was still alive. 

On a complaint by the activist, Usha Soni, the Goregaon have registered an FIR against the “driver” of vehicle number MH02 FB 5001.  Singh, a resident of Imperial Heights, has produced hits like Tanu Weds Manu, Madari and Shahid. Soni too lives in the same society.
